Output 45c51508915db03902654f81f0a29b3e8524bb9de75366d4a2987a0232621c58:1

value
1271241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ff4847f3d1e6e0ee39ca172ac61d4eb6cea0ac OP_EQUAL
address
344UdfhR5mBN7r5Geq6jPZWdkhUznTmhED
transaction
45c51508915db03902654f81f0a29b3e8524bb9de75366d4a2987a0232621c58
spent
true